XOOX, a pet networking service (PNS) application featuring short-form content challenges, launched this month, winning over global pet owners. XOOX commenced its service with an advertisement in New York’s Times Square, underscoring its exclusive focus on our four-legged companions.

XOOX operates uniquely under pet accounts through Pet ID registration devised by XOOX’s global research and AI teams, including veterinary experts worldwide, utilizing innovative biometric identification techniques such as eyelid patterns and eye wrinkles. XOOX’s research team stated, “Through Pet ID, pets are recognized as account users on XOOX, allowing them to engage in various activities such as pet registration, insurance, health management, and making friends,” adding, “To enhance the accuracy of biometric recognition, we adopted a method that is a step up from nose prints and iris scans.”

In XOOX, pets become influencers through their IDs, boosting visibility by sharing their daily lives, engaging with followers, and participating in short-form content challenges. They earn points for various activities, usable in connected apps, for creating avatars, and for product purchases. Pet owners, known as Petlers, manage their pets’ IDs and support them in their activities. Striving to foster a positive shift in attitudes toward pets, XOOX welcomes individuals who currently do not own pets to also join. However, posting content is not a feature available to them at this time.
